- Q: How should I store crushed red pepper? A: Store it in a cool, dry place. Keeping it away from moisture will help maintain its flavor and freshness.
- Q: What is the shelf-life of crushed red pepper? A: The shelf-life is generally two to three years if stored properly. However, for the best flavor, use it within a year.

- Q: Is there a difference between crushed red pepper and red pepper flakes? A: No, they are essentially the same. Both terms refer to dried and crushed red chili peppers.
